Solaris 10 lacks support for some newer realtek gigE chips.  OpenSolaris 
has it, though... more recent is better.

> my ifconfig -a shows lo0 for mtu 8232 index 1
> nge0 shows mtu 1500 index 2 inet 0.0.0.0 netmask 0and ether 0:mac add:6e
>   

looks like you need to assign an IP address to nge.... if you're using 
DHCP, you can try doing "ifconfig nge0 dhcp start".  Note that NWAM 
should make this unnecessary, but NWAM is not enabled by default in all 
installations of OpenSolaris.  (It should have been for SXDE 9/07, 
though.  So that's a bit of a surprise.)
